当涉及到购买数量的增加和减少时,通常会使用JavaScript来处理用户的交互操作。以下是一个简单的示例,展示了如何使用JavaScript来实现购买数量的增减功能,并解释其中的基础概念和相关优势。
以下是一个简单的HTML和JavaScript代码示例,用于实现购买数量的增加和减少: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>购买数量增减</title>
</head>
<body>
<div>
<button id="decrementBtn">-</button>
<span id="quantity">0</span>
<button id="incrementBtn">+</button>
</div>
<script>
// 获取DOM元素
const quantityElement = document.getElementById('quantity');
const incrementBtn = document.getElementById('incrementBtn');
const decrementBtn = document.getElementById('decrementBtn');
// 初始化数量
let quantity = 0;
// 更新显示的数量
function updateQuantity() {
quantityElement.textContent = quantity;
}
// 增加数量
incrementBtn.addEventListener('click', () => {
quantity++;
updateQuantity();
});
// 减少数量
decrementBtn.addEventListener('click', () => {
if (quantity > 0) {
quantity--;
updateQuantity();
}
});
</script>
</body>
</html>
decrementBtn.addEventListener('click', () => {
if (quantity > 0) {
quantity--;
updateQuantity();
}
});
通过以上示例和解释,你应该能够理解如何使用JavaScript实现购买数量的增减功能,并了解其中的基础概念和相关优势。如果有更多具体问题或需要进一步的帮助,请随时提问。
领取专属 10元无门槛券
手把手带您无忧上云